学生,初中“VB程序设计”课实践和深思写作策略

更新时间:2024-03-03 点赞:27298 浏览:121919 作者:用户投稿原创标记本站原创

初信息技术课程是一门立足于实践、创造、与人文融合的综合的课程。它分为两,一是必修课:学习信息技术知识与对常用软件的操作,培养学生的的信息素养;另外一是选修课:有“VB程序设计”及“饥器人”,条件所限,数学校都开设了“VB程序设计”这门课程。在近几年的VB教学中,我数学生只能学会些的操作,对于如何将所学技艺运用于实际的不足解决中仍然有着不足,我经过几年来的不断反思、再实践,设置良好的情境氛围,具有挑战性的不足来吸引学生,并将知识要点融于的任务中,“学以致用,以用促学”,是教学效果好坏的,现浅谈如下一些感受:

一、使程序设计贴近生活,让学生”学习”

陶行知先生曾说过“生活即教育”,我考虑到在接触程序设计以前,学生的学习在对软件产品的操作学习上,的知识背景是对常用操作系统有初步,能使用常用的办公软件,所以,我在堂课讲解“程序设计入门”中,我使用了小时候都玩过的“抢三十”游戏入手,让学生与计算机抢三十,不足,一下子就让学生感到程序并不神秘。接着在讲解“是VB,VB能做,有特点”这些时,和学生在一起用以前学过的软件的操作中浅析出来的,在运用程序中哪里了、事件、策略。这样,编程的课台阶并不高,它学生建立最的。这样,激发的好奇心和学习动力,形成了良好的课堂氛围。

二、在程序设计中寻找解决不足的策略,让学生“学以致用”

循环结构是三种结构中最难掌握的结构,在学习中,我设计了“智障人卖冰棍”的例子,以故事的策略引入课题:我这里有故事,故事的主人公是智障人,其他都挺正常的,只要你让他事情,他都能不折不扣地完成,不知道该做。他父亲想给他解决工作不足,就开了个小店本科毕业论文,只要卖卖东西就行了。他该怎么做呢?大家给他设计工作流程图吧?大家设计的程序流程图,智障人就知道该干了。接下来,我和学生一起解决不足,认知冲突教学的策略被大量地用在这一阶段的论述学习中,实践证明这一策略激发了学生潜在的求知欲,以不足解决出发,亲历处理信息、开展交流、合作的,达到学习目的。以开始学习时的惧怕心理到后来慢慢地在享受深思的快乐。

三、设立多级学习,因材施教——“分层教学”

学生的和认知特点有差别,在论述课上我设立了多级学习。比如,在编写“加法练习器”程序中遇到全局变量与局部变量_的,对于这些,我先不将它展开,并且布置课后完成的“讨论和深思”题里也涉及变量的定义不足。
好的同学就开始查去学习,但仍然有疑惑,而大的学生对该实验似懂非懂。面对差别,我对学生的倡议是:先做,而把实践放到后面的综合实验当中。综合实践出来的程序就很不一样了,学生设计的程序是多样的,有个性的,这也学生的认知差别。老师,如何处理差别,多样化的自主探讨空间给学生,不同的意见和创造性思维的进发是学好VB程序设计的另一大法宝。

四、“任务驱动”开展实验教学——“以用促学”

陶行知最,教、学都要以“做”为,实验在程序设计课里占有的位置。每节实验课前都有相对完整的论述学习,所以我设计的案例里,每个实验都“任务驱动”的教学策略。中,学生项设计任务的完成,个技术不足的探究,激发创造的,享受创造的乐趣。培养的创造性想象能力、批判性思维能力,在实践中不断革新的能力,形成积极、果敢、合作、进取等品质。我在中,除了实验前的五分钟指导、强调实验目的、提示操作技艺和实验当中对的不足的讲解之外,一般不去干扰学生的自主实验,对同学单独指导。学生会在实验中自发地形成小组合作学习,也正是方式让体验表达自我、求同存异、和欣赏等情感的。对好的同学,我给出新的实验内容。整个实验教学。我都认真地把握了学生的学习情况,并在后续的论述课上给出实验的指导。
在论述课教学中,我淡化了教学要求“算法”这一,在一开始就讲解“算法”经典算法内容,以VB的人手,这样比较面向程序设计语言VISUAL BASIC的本身特点,也使得学生程序设计学习的门槛低些,建立学生的自信心。在后续的教学中用“解决不足的策略”这一算法的定义来代替算法一词,把有关算法穿插在论述课和实验课当中。学生在潜移默化中对算法的就自然地建立了。
对VB程序设计的教学,我仍然有不少困惑,比如对教材的处理,对教学效果的评估,评价学生的方式等等。这些我都将在下一轮的教学当中去实践和总结。而这一轮收获到的教育、教学快乐都将我在这一更大的精力、热情,服务于我所热爱的事业。


相关文章
推荐阅读

 发表评论

共有3000条评论 快来参与吧~